当前位置:首页 > 问问

单片机初学者适合买什么样的开发板 单片机初学者适合选哪款开发板?

1、平台选择

首先,单片机初学者应该明确自己所要购买的开发板使用的平台,如STC、AVR、PIC等等。目前市面上比较常见的单片机开发板有两种:一种是基于Arduino平台的开发板,另一种则是基于传统单片机的开发板。

如果你想要快速上手,建议选择基于Arduino平台的开发板,因为Arduino平台具有简单易学、丰富的资料和开发资源、且有全球广泛的用户社区等优势。

如果你对单片机有更深入的了解,且需要探索更多单片机的功能和底层操作,建议选择传统单片机的开发板,如STC89C52、AT89S52等等。需要注意的是,传统单片机的资料和资源相对来说比Arduino平台的资源要少一些。

2、功能选择

单片机的种类非常多,各种各样的单片机有着不同的检测、控制和通信功能。初学者在购买开发板时,应该首先考虑自己所需要的功能。建议初学者在初期购买开发板时,不要选择功能过于强大复杂的开发板,否则容易使自己深入瓶颈。

一般来说,初学者可以选择带有基本的GPIO引脚、PWM输出、UART通信、ADC输入等常用核心功能的开发板。这样的开发板可以让你通过实验来更好地理解单片机的基本功能,逐渐了解单片机的工作原理和编程思想。

3、价格选择

价格也是选择开发板时需要考虑的因素之一。不少刚刚踏入单片机世界的新手对价格敏感。初学者可以选择一些价格合理、性价比较高的开发板,比如淘宝上的DIY套件和某宝上的开发板。

值得注意的是,价格较低的单片机开发板有可能存在一些质量问题,或者支持较少的接口,对于初学者来说可能会存在一些困难。因此建议初学者根据自己的经济情况和需求,选择价格适中、性能良好的开发板。

4、开发环境

在选择单片机开发板时,还需要考虑开发环境。对于不同的单片机开发板,需要使用不同的开发工具以及编程语言。基于Arduino平台的开发板,常用的编程语言是Arduino语言(C++语言的一种变体);而传统单片机的开发则需要掌握更为专业的编程语言,如C语言、汇编语言等。

初学者建议优先选择基于Arduino平台的开发板,因为Arduino平台的开发环境相对更加友好,简单易上手。对于基于传统单片机的开发板,建议通过阅读相关资料和教程,多进行实践和尝试,逐步掌握其开发环境和相关的编程语言。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章